Shopping centre owner in deal to remove barriers stifling growth | Business

An organization backed by SoftBank that transforms under-utilised automotive parks and buying centres into city farms, neighbourhood kitchens, fulfilment centres and e-scooter rental stations has agreed its first deal in Britain.

Reef Technology, which was based in Miami, has signed a deal with Capital & Regional, the London-listed landlord that owns seven buying centres.

Finding various makes use of for elements of Capital & Regional’s malls in Luton, Bedfordshire, and Wood Green, north London, heads the to-do record. Discussions are additionally underneath manner to utilise house on the landlord’s centres in Walthamstow and Ilford.

Reef was fashioned as ParkJockey, offering administration providers for automotive parks. It has expanded to present infrastructure for storage and fulfilment centres, with Reef couriers delivering packages on e-scooters.
